Protocol for embedded 3D printing of heart tissues using thiol-norbornene collagen

STAR Protocols [2024]
Zili Gao, Shenglong Ding, Tingting Fan, Wenhui Huang, Xiyuan Zhao, Xin Liu, Wenli Liu, Mingzhu Zhang, Qi Gu
ABSTRACT

Summary Here, we present a protocol for 3D printing heart tissues using thiol-norbornene photoclick collagen (NorCol). We describe steps for synthesizing NorCol, preparing bioink and the support bath, and cell-laden printing. We then detail procedures for the loading of C2C12 cells into NorCol, ensuring structural integrity and cell viability after printing. This protocol is adaptable to various cell lines and allows for the printing of diverse complex structures, which can be used in drug screening and disease modeling.
